The Metro Council of Nashville and Davidson County has approved an ordinance establishing building material restrictions for the mixed-use development at 1500 3rd Avenue North. The ordinance mandates that building facades be constructed using brick, brick veneer, stone, cast stone, cementitious siding, glass, metal panel, or other materials substantially similar in form and function. The ordinance is part of the rezoning under BL2024-647, ensuring architectural quality within the development site. These standards align with the Dickerson Pike Sign Urban Design Overlay, reinforcing consistent design principles for the hospitality and commercial elements of the project.
